Pre-Purchase Checklist for Used Teslas

Battery Performance Check

The battery is a critical component of any Tesla, directly influencing its range and overall value. Start by checking the dashboard's estimated range, which gives a general idea of battery health. For a deeper dive, use tools like the Tesla app, ScanMyTesla, or TeslaFi to assess key metrics such as cell voltages, temperature consistency, and current capacity [2].

Measurement What to Look For
Cell Voltages Uniform readings across all cells
Temperature Patterns Consistent readings, no hot spots
Current Capacity Compare with the original specifications

Lastly, double-check the warranty details to protect your purchase.

Warranty Status

Understanding the warranty coverage is crucial. If you're buying through Tesla's certified pre-owned program, the vehicle comes with a Used Vehicle Limited Warranty. The Basic Vehicle Limited Warranty covers 4 years or 50,000 miles from the original purchase date. After that, the Used Vehicle Limited Warranty adds 1 year or 10,000 miles of coverage. Additionally, the Battery and Drive Unit Limited Warranty transfers to new owners, offering further peace of mind [3].

Software and Tech Features

Tesla's over-the-air updates and advanced tech features are key to its driving experience. After evaluating the hardware and warranty, review the software and technology.

Feature Category Check Points
Current Software Version Accessible under Settings > Software tab [4]
Hardware Version Found via Settings > Software > Additional Vehicle Information [5]
Available Upgrades Look for purchasable performance or capability updates
FSD Hardware Ensure compatibility with the latest features

Service and Repair Records

A thorough review of service and repair records is essential. Look for:

  • Documentation of routine maintenance, including Tesla-recommended intervals
  • Records of software updates and any associated service bulletins
  • Detailed repair history, especially for the battery and drive unit

For an even more detailed assessment, schedule an inspection at a Tesla Service Center [2].

Los Angeles Tesla Market Prices

The used Tesla market in Los Angeles has seen noticeable price changes, making it important for buyers to stay updated on trends.

Local Price Ranges

Used Tesla prices in Los Angeles have shifted over time, with the average prices for popular models becoming more competitive:

Model Current Average Price 90-Day Price Change Annual Change
Model 3 $23,622 -4.19% -7.26%
Model Y $30,399 -2.90% -7.26%
Model S $85,409 -5.10% -7.26%
Model X $83,457 -3.90% -7.26%

These changes suggest that used Tesla values are depreciating faster than traditional vehicles. Brian Moody, executive editor of Autotrader, explains, "Tesla has to compete with all of those cars in a marketplace that they basically helped to define" [8].

Price Impact Factors

Several factors influence the pricing of used Teslas in Los Angeles:

  • Model-Specific Depreciation: The Model 3 saw a sharp price drop of 16.8% between September and December 2022 [6]. By early 2023, Model 3 and Model Y prices had settled at about 27% below their July 2022 peak [7].

  • Market Dynamics: Demand for used Teslas has decreased by 16% in the past month [8]. On average, electric vehicles tend to lose value 11% faster than gasoline-powered cars [8].

  • Configuration Impact: Features like Full Self-Driving capability, battery range, premium interiors, and performance upgrades heavily influence resale values. For example, Model S prices fell 5.2% to $90,000 for the AWD version, while Model X prices dropped 9.1% to $100,000 [7].

These factors highlight the importance of understanding the market before making a purchase.

Test Drive and Inspection Guide

After completing your pre-purchase checklist, follow these steps to assess the vehicle's condition and performance.

Test Drive Steps

Take the car for a test drive to get a feel for its performance and ensure everything works as it should. Pay close attention to these areas:

  • Performance Systems: Test how the car accelerates, brakes, and handles in various drive modes.
  • Autopilot Features: Check the functionality of FSD, AP, or Enhanced AP systems.
  • Climate Control: Run the climate control at full power and listen for any unusual sounds.
  • Comfort Features: Test heated seats and the steering wheel to ensure they work properly.
  • Electronics: Confirm that backup and side cameras are functioning.
  • Audio System: Play music at different volumes to check speaker quality.
  • Basic Operations: Test window and seat adjustments for smooth operation.

Visual Inspection Points

A visual check can help you spot potential problems early. Here’s what to look for:

Exterior Check:

  • Inspect body panels for alignment issues, especially around the trunk lid.
  • Test all lights, including emergency signals, turn signals, and fog lights.
  • Look for chips or cracks in the windshield or glass roof panels.
  • Examine paint for inconsistencies or signs of past repairs.
  • Check tire tread depth and the condition of brake pads.

Interior Check:

  • Test seat adjustments in all directions to ensure smooth movement.
  • Look for wear, tears, or stains on the upholstery.
  • Check for moisture under the floor mats.
  • Verify the touchscreen’s functionality and display clarity.
  • Make sure all interior lights are working.

Charging Components:

  • Inspect the charge port for any signs of damage.
  • Test charging with the adapters provided.
  • Ensure the charging equipment latches and unlatches properly.

Purchase Checklist Review

Before you finalize your purchase, take a moment to double-check the essentials. Start by confirming that the VIN matches across all documents. Make sure any advertised features, such as Autopilot options (FSD, AP, or EAP), are included. Also, verify the warranty coverage for both the Basic Vehicle Limited and Battery/Drive Unit warranties.

Here are some key components to inspect:

Component What to Verify Why It Matters
Battery Pack Look for any signs of damage Impacts long-term reliability
Charging Equipment Ensure UMC cable and adapters are included Necessary for home charging
Documentation Review service records and check recall status Confirms maintenance history

These steps will help you make an informed decision and avoid surprises down the road.
